Multi desktops

0/5 (16 avis)

Vue 5 726 fois - Téléchargée 632 fois

Description

Une application multi-desktops qui peut aider les débutants et offrir un retour aux sources aux experts habitués aux ateliers de développements sophistiqués.
Avec 50 kilos de code source CPP (88 générés), ne faisant appel qu?aux APIs NT on peut s?offrir à moindre frais 8 bureaux avec leurs menus personnalisables et une fonctionnalité de capture d?écran. Les explications d?usage sont dans le fichier d?aide, les commentaires intéressants, du moins je l?espère, sont dans le code source de la classe CAM6Bureau.
J?oubliais :
- Un fichier de logs est généré pour garder une trace de mes coquilles si problème il y a.
- la classe AMMenu n?est pas toute neuve, peu commentée, peu soignée et n?a rien d?un template mais elle est bien trop pratique pour que je m?en sépare.
- les classes CLog2File et CAM6FileException représentent le stricte minimum pour la gestion des logs et des exceptions, peut faire mieux c?est sur.

Codes Sources

A voir également

Ajouter un commentaire Commentaires
AndreJAO
Messages postés
24
Date d'inscription
samedi 15 mai 2004
Statut
Membre
Dernière intervention
2 septembre 2007

3 sept. 2006 à 20:35
Pour ne pas confondre Multi-Desktops et bureaux virtuels
Une application Multi-Desktops traitent effectivement l'aspect objet Desktop des OS Microsoft et par le fait utilise le multi threads
Une aplication bureaux virtuels fournit bien une fonctionnalité multi-desktops, plusieurs bureaux d'un point de vue purement fonctionnel, mais n'utilise pas obliatoirement les objets Desktop.
Ceci dit je suis vraiment sous le charme de l'application de http://www.cppfrance.com/auteur/VECCHIO56/19734.aspx
c'est vraiment efficace et tellement plus léger qu'une application multi-desktops telle que je l'ai réalisé
skone007
Messages postés
166
Date d'inscription
mercredi 24 avril 2002
Statut
Membre
Dernière intervention
23 juin 2009

30 août 2006 à 16:15
Merci pour cette source ...
cs_jmhC
Messages postés
108
Date d'inscription
vendredi 24 janvier 2003
Statut
Membre
Dernière intervention
10 août 2007

27 août 2006 à 21:12
Aprés ce test, cela fonctionne.
Donc RAS.
cs_jmhC
Messages postés
108
Date d'inscription
vendredi 24 janvier 2003
Statut
Membre
Dernière intervention
10 août 2007

27 août 2006 à 15:31
Je vais faire ce test.
Merci.
AndreJAO
Messages postés
24
Date d'inscription
samedi 15 mai 2004
Statut
Membre
Dernière intervention
2 septembre 2007

27 août 2006 à 14:15
Les explorer restent actifs !
Certainement pas s'ils ont été invoqués en tant qu'interface utilisateur avec la spécification
[Bureau 2]
GUI=explorer.exe
[Bureau 3]
GUI=explorer.exe
[Bureau 4]
GUI=explorer.exe
[Bureau 5]
GGUI=explorer.exe
[Bureau 7]
GUI=explorer.exe
[Bureau 6]
GUI=explorer.exe
[Bureau 8]
GUI=explorer.exe
Les applications restent actives après fermeture des bureaux !
Certainement, rien est écrit pour fermer les applications après fermeture des bureaux.
La bonne question: Peut on le faire ?
Certainement mais quel beau morceau de code, à nous de jouer ...
je m'abstiendrai en connaissance de cause et en raison du peu d'intérêt fonctionnel de l'enjeu.
Afficher les 16 commentaires

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.